J.J. Watt says Tom Brady is still the GOAT of the NFL


The debate over the greatest of all time (GOAT) in sports often centers on soccer and American football figures. While Lionel Messi dominates soccer, Patrick Mahomes is making significant waves in the NFL, potentially on track for his fourth Super Bowl victory in five seasons. J.J. Watt weighs in on whether Mahomes should be compared to Messi or Tom Brady.

Watt discussed his perspective on the GOAT debate with FC legend Jamie Carragher on the podcast 'It's Called Soccer'. "You are certainly getting to that level of conversation. I think Tom is still the Messi. Tom Brady is still the GOAT. Tom Brady holds that title and he's going to hold that title. I mean seven rings, everything that he has done," Watt stated.


Watt says Mahomes is running out of time to win his Super Bowl legacy, which will probably be a historic three-peat and put him behind Brady. Two MVP awards and 29 years of experience will give Mahomes plenty of opportunities to further strengthen his legacy.

Watt says he has huge respect for Mahomes, whose rise to superstardom as the face of the NFL makes him deserving of accolades like global sports icons such as Messi. Watt concluded, "Tom Brady is still the GOAT.”
